Factors to Consider When Choosing a Face Wash for Hormonal Acne and Sensitive Skin

When choosing a face wash for hormonal acne and sensitive skin, you want to look for a gentle cleansing formulation that doesn’t strip your skin or cause irritation—that’s the foundation. You should also consider oil control abilities to manage excess sebum without over-drying, plus ingredients that balance sensitivity and fight acne effectively. Finally, prioritize products with barrier restoration benefits, so your skin gets strengthened and less reactive over time, kind of like a workout for your face, but without the sweat.

Gentle Cleansing Formulation

Choosing a gentle cleanser is more than just picking something mild. It’s about understanding what makes a product kind to sensitive skin, especially when your hormones change. Look for a cleanser with a pH close to 5.5. This helps keep your skin’s natural barrier healthy. Stay away from harsh ingredients like sulfates. These can remove moisture and cause irritation. Instead, choose a product with calming ingredients like niacinamide or thermal water. These help reduce redness and soothe your skin. You can also find light exfoliants, like PHA or gentle enzymes, which help keep your pores clean without being too rough. Lastly, check the label. Pick products that are fragrance-free, alcohol-free, and preservative-free. These small choices can lower the chance of allergic reactions and irritation. This way, your sensitive skin stays comfortable, balanced, and happy.

Acne-Fighting Ingredients

When choosing a face wash for hormonal acne and sensitive skin, it’s important to know about key ingredients. These ingredients include salicylic acid, benzoyl peroxide, and exfoliating acids.

Salicylic acid is a type of BHA. It goes deep into pores to help clear out dead skin and extra oil. This helps stop blackheads and pimples from forming. Benzoyl peroxide is a strong ingredient that kills the bacteria that cause acne. If you use it regularly, you might see clearer skin in about a week. Exfoliating acids, such as AHAs, BHA, and PHAs, help to smooth skin. They also unclog pores and make your skin look brighter.

If your skin is sensitive, you should be careful. Using these ingredients together can cause irritation. To avoid that, look for calming ingredients like cucumber or licorice root. These help soothe your skin and keep it balanced.

Choosing the right ingredients can make your skin feel healthier and look better. Always remember to start slowly and see how your skin reacts.

Barrier Restoration Benefits

Choosing the right face wash can help your skin stay healthy and strong, especially if you have hormonal acne and sensitive skin. Look for cleansers that have ingredients like ceramides, niacinamide, or centella extract. These help boost your skin’s natural barrier, which keeps moisture in and harmful stuff out. When your barrier is strong, your skin is less dry, less red, and less sensitive, even when you use cleansers.

Stay away from products with sulfates, strong fragrances, or harsh surfactants. These ingredients can strip away too much of your skin’s natural oils and make your barrier weaker. Using gentle, barrier-supporting cleansers regularly helps your skin become more resilient. It also helps protect it from pollution and changing weather.

These ingredients also help control oil and keep your skin’s pH balanced. This can help reduce hormonal breakouts and keep your skin clear. Think of your skin’s barrier like armor. When you take good care of it, your skin can stay healthy, calm, and ready to fight off problems.
